Best 56156 Minnesota Public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 4 public schools serving 1,155 students in 56156, MN.
The top-ranked public schools in 56156, MN are Luverne Elementary School, Luverne Middle School and Luverne Senior High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 56156 have an average math proficiency score of 60% (versus the Minnesota public school average of 46%), and reading proficiency score of 61% (versus the 51% statewide average). Schools in 56156, MN have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Minnesota public schools.
Minority enrollment is 15%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Minnesota public school average of 39% (majority Black and Hispanic).
